Begin your procurement journey with rigorous supplier verification. The term “mold factory” in China can range from sophisticated operations with full in-house capabilities to basic workshops. To filter effectively, start by demanding evidence of specific experience with soft plastics. Request detailed case studies or samples of previous molds for similar materials like PVC, TPE, or silicone. A competent supplier will readily provide this. Next, verify their technical prowess by inquiring about their design software (e.g., UG, Pro/E), their ability to handle complex geometries common in soft plastic lures or seals, and their experience with specific surface finishes like texture or polishing that are crucial for final product release. Initial communication should be technical and detailed; a factory that asks insightful questions about your material grade, expected cycle life, and tolerance requirements is demonstrating professional competence essential for creating successful custom molds for soft plastics.
Once a shortlist is established, a deep dive into their quality control infrastructure is non-negotiable. The cornerstone of a reliable China mold factory is its commitment to measurable quality at every stage. Probe their process: Do they use precision equipment like CNC, EDM, and wire-cutting machines? What is their protocol for first-article inspection? Insist on a documented quality control plan that includes material certificates for the mold steel (such as H13, S136), critical dimension checks at each machining stage, and a comprehensive trial run (T1) report. For injection molds used with soft plastics, pay special attention to their testing of gate design, cooling channels, and venting—imperfections here directly cause defects like air traps or incomplete filling. A trustworthy supplier will welcome this scrutiny and may offer live video inspections of key milestones, providing transparent oversight throughout the manufacturing process.
The commercial and legal framework of your order is as vital as the technical specifications. A professional procurement strategy protects your investment. Always insist on a detailed, itemized quotation that breaks down costs for design, materials, machining, heat treatment, trials, and shipping. Beware of suspiciously low bids; they often signal compromises in steel quality or craftsmanship. The contract must explicitly define deliverables: 3D mold design files (STEP, IGS), the number of trial shots included, approval procedures for the T1 sample, and the protocol for modifications. Clearly state ownership of all design and mold intellectual property. For payment, a staggered schedule (e.g., 30% deposit, 40% after approval of T1 samples, 30% before shipment) is standard and aligns incentives. This structured approach separates professional partners from opportunistic vendors.
Effective management of the sampling and production launch phase is where quality is ultimately validated. The first trial (T1) is your most critical checkpoint. When you receive sample shots, evaluate them against rigorous criteria: dimensional accuracy, surface finish, flashing, and the functionality of any moving parts like sliders or lifters. Provide clear, annotated feedback. A top supplier will have a systematic engineering response to your feedback, proposing precise adjustments to the mold. Discuss their capacity for mold maintenance and repair, and establish terms for future spare parts. Furthermore, inquire about their ability to support volume production, whether they can recommend reputable local injection molding partners or manage low-volume production themselves, ensuring a seamless transition from prototype to finished goods.
